And here's Brutus :D He's the same male xiloaensis that's in my avatar. As you can see his hump has gone down. The pic in my avatar was taken when I had his brother who was approximately the same size. Brutus' hump was huge when he was dominant over his brother and trying to impress the female. He's still a hoss though :)

nope, no breeding yet. now that I think about it, the hump went down when I moved about 6 weeks ago, and that was when the suspected female died...she didn't survive the move. His hump hasn't come back since then. Maybe it'll come back when he hopefully takes a liking to one of the new females.
 
really nice looking fish. Brutus looks great its crazy how much the hump can go up and down like that. Makes an argument for keeping some fish together in that aspect as opposed to solo. He still looks huge
